9.3: Maintain and Enforce Network-Based URL Filters

Enforce and update network-based URL filters to limit an enterprise asset from connecting to potentially malicious or unapproved websites. Example implementations include category-based filtering, reputation-based filtering, or through the use of block lists. Enforce filters for all enterprise assets.

Inputs

  1. GV1: Enterprise asset inventory

  2. GV3: Configuration standards

  3. GV5: Authorized software inventory

Operations

  1. Use GV1 to identify and enumerate enterprise assets capable of supporting network-based URL filters (M1)

  2. Use GV5 to identify authorized web browsers/clients

  3. For each asset identified in Operation 1 check to see if it is configured properly GV3 to support authorized web browsers/clients from Operation 2
    1. Identify and enumerate assets properly configured (M2)

    2. Identify and enumerate assets not properly configured (M3)

Measures

  • M1 = Count of enterprise assets capable of supporting network-based URL filters

  • M2 = Count of assets properly configured to support network-based URL filters

  • M3 = Count of assets not properly configured to support network-based URL filters

Metrics

Coverage

Metric

The percentage of assets configured to use authorized network-based URL filters

Calculation

M2 / M1
